Esthetician Training Requirements

Miamisburg Ohio esthetician giving wax treatmentEstheticians are highly trained, in-demand skincare experts, which is why an esthetics program requires around 600 hours of hands-on training hours. For licensure, you need to demonstrate a thorough understanding of the skin and the technology used in advanced treatments like lasers, LED lights, oxygen, or ultrasonic waves. Keep in mind that program requirements can vary by state, but most states require at least 600 hours of training to obtain a license in the field. In addition to training, estheticians should also have a professional and friendly personality that instills confidence in their clients. A skilled esthetician must be able to listen and empathize with their clients’ needs and concerns, often personalizing treatment for them.

Esthetician Job Description

As skilled skincare experts, estheticians need to be knowledgeable of everything from skin histology and physiology to bacteriology and sanitation protocols. As beauty professionals, estheticians must be trained to perform the services that promote healthy, radiant skin – including everything from hair removal methods, pore cleansing and extractions to microdermabrasion, makeup artistry, chemical peels, and light therapy. As beauty and wellness experts, people also turn to estheticians for consultations, advice, and tips for home skincare regimens. They may recommend products, educate clients, and recommend esthetic procedures based on their clients’ needs and wants. Their work environments can include Miamisburg Ohio spas, resorts, salons, hospitals, nursing facilities and dermatologist offices.

Online Esthetician Schools

Miamisburg Ohio woman taking esthetician classes onlineOnline esthetician programs are accommodating for Miamisburg OH students who are employed full-time and have family obligations that make it hard to enroll in a more traditional school. There are a large number of web-based beauty school programs available that can be attended via a desktop computer or laptop at the student's convenience. More conventional cosmetology programs are frequently fast paced because many programs are as brief as six or eight months. This means that a considerable portion of time is spent in the classroom. With online courses, you are covering the same volume of material, but you're not devoting numerous hours outside of your home or travelling back and forth from classes. However, it's vital that the program you choose can provide internship training in local salons and parlors in order that you also get the hands-on training required for a complete education. Without the internship portion of the training, it's impossible to gain the skills required to work in any area of the cosmetology field. So be sure if you decide to enroll in an online school to confirm that internship training is provided in your area.

Is the Esthetician Program Accredited? It's important to make certain that the esthetician college you enroll in is accredited. The accreditation should be by a U.S. Department of Education recognized local or national organization, such as the National Accrediting Commission for Cosmetology Arts & Sciences (NACCAS). Schools accredited by the NACCAS must meet their high standards guaranteeing a quality curriculum and education. Accreditation can also be essential for getting student loans or financial aid, which often are not obtainable for non- accredited schools. It's also a requirement for licensing in some states that the training be accredited. And as a concluding benefit, a number of Miamisburg OH businesses will not employ recent graduates of non-accredited schools, or might look more positively upon individuals with accredited training.

Does the School have an Excellent Reputation?  Each esthetician college that you are seriously evaluating should have a good to exceptional reputation within the profession. Being accredited is an excellent starting point. Next, ask the schools for testimonials from their network of businesses where they have placed their students. Confirm that the schools have high job placement rates, attesting that their students are highly sought after. Visit rating services for reviews together with the school's accrediting agencies. If you have any connections with Miamisburg OH salon owners or managers, or any person working in the business, ask them if they are familiar with the schools you are reviewing. They might even be able to recommend others that you had not looked into. And finally, check with the Ohio school licensing authority to see if there have been any grievances filed or if the schools are in complete compliance.

What’s the School’s Focus?  Some esthetician schools offer programs that are expansive in nature, concentrating on all facets of cosmetology. Others are more focused, providing training in a particular specialty, for example hairstyling, manicuring or electrolysis. Schools that offer degree programs typically expand into a management and marketing curriculum. So it's important that you choose a school that specializes in your area of interest. Since your goal is to be trained as an esthetician, make certain that the school you enroll in is accredited and respected for that program. If your desire is to launch a Miamisburg OH beauty salon, then you need to enroll in a degree program that will teach you how to be an owner/operator as well. Selecting a highly ranked school with a poor program in the specialty you are pursuing will not provide the training you need.

Is Plenty of Hands-On Training Provided?  Studying and perfecting esthetician techniques and abilities requires plenty of practice on people. Find out how much live, hands-on training is included in the cosmetology lessons you will be attending. A number of schools have salons on site that enable students to practice their developing talents on volunteers. If a beauty academy provides minimal or no scheduled live training, but instead depends heavily on utilizing mannequins, it might not be the most effective alternative for developing your skills. Therefore look for other schools that provide this type of training.

Does the School have a Job Placement Program?  Once a student graduates from an esthetician program, it's important that she or he receives support in landing that first job. Job placement programs are an important part of that process. Schools that furnish assistance develop relationships with Miamisburg OH employers that are searching for qualified graduates available for hiring. Check that the schools you are contemplating have job placement programs and find out which salons and businesses they refer students to. In addition, find out what their job placement rates are. Higher rates not only verify that they have wide networks of employers, but that their programs are highly respected as well.

Is Financial Aid Offered?  The majority of esthetician schools offer financial aid or student loan assistance for their students. Ask if the schools you are considering have a financial aid office. Speak with a counselor and find out what student loans or grants you might qualify for. If the school belongs to the American Association of Cosmetology Schools (AACS), it will have scholarships offered to students also. If a school meets all of your other qualifications with the exception of cost, do not discard it as an option until you find out what financial help may be available.
